Vimax is a supplement for men that claims to help erectile dysfunction, low libido, and stamina issues during sexual intercourse. It uses various all-natural herbs from different countries to combat these problems. They say their product is used by men from ages 18-78, and that they hold themselves to very high standards in development, manufacturing, and product research.

Tribulus Terrestris, one of the main ingredients in Vimax, is becoming more and more popular in its use for boosting testosterone and for increasing sexual desire in men. As men age, testosterone levels can quickly drop. Taking herbs such as Tribulus Terrestris has shown to be beneficial in preventing premature aging in many men. If men lose testosterone, their desire can significantly drop.
Horny Goat Weed, Ginseng, and Saw Palmetto can all work together to improve sexual function. Horny Goat Weed can stimulate production of nitric oxide and give men more desire, and has long been used as an aphrodisiac. When the nitric oxide is stimulated, blood should start flowing into the penis, forming a strong erection. If blood is not flowing properly, Ginseng and Saw Palmetto can act together to combat this problem, allowing for a larger, firmer erection as blood freely flows into the caverns of the penis.
